For more details on the INT Directorate,.. > > > > Summary: I don't think there are any Internet issues in this document. > > I think it's in good shape for publishing as Informational document. I > > found the Appendix C was helpful, as I'm not an expert in 5G > > deployments. > > > > This document recommends encoding of the IP addressing in section 4.2 > > using most significant 96-bits to simplify mapping tables. > > [Med] Please note that the document does not recommend it per se. It is > provided as an example to simplify the mapping table: > > The mapping table can be simplified if, for example, IPv6 addressing is > used to > address NFs. > > There is > > nothing wrong with this, but it should be noted for privacy and other > > considerations if/when deploying over the public internet space. > > [Med] Thanks. Tried to generalize the concern by adding this new text: > > NEW: > In order to avoid the need for a mapping table to associate source/ > destination IP addresses and slices' specific S-NSSAIs, Section 4.2 > describes an approach where some or all S-NSSAI bits are embedded in > an IPv6 address using an algorithm approach. An attacker from within > the transport network who has access to the mapping configuration may > infer the slices to which belong a packet. It may also alter these > bits which may lead to steering the packet via a distinct network > slice, and thus lead to service disruption. Note that such an on- > path attacker may make more damage (e.g., randomly drop packets). > > > Section 5.2.1 allows for IPv6 encapsulation using SR6, so there is no > > issue with MTU that any encapsulation technique would encounter. It > > uses DSCP for QoS, so there no use of flow labels or additional > > headers. > > > > Nits: > > Figure 32 table has some formatting errors. > > > > [Med] Thanks for reporting this.
